https://leetcode.com/problems/spiral-matrix/ 题意分析: 输入一个m×n的数字矩阵。将这个矩阵按照螺旋方向输成一列。比如: [ [ 1, 2, 3 ], [ 4, 5, 6 ], [ 7, 8, 9 ] ] 输出[1,2,3,6,9,8,7,4,5] 题目思路: 这道题目只需要模拟这个过程。分四步,第一步行左到右,第二步从上到下...
down+1):res.append(matrix[i][right])right-=1ifdirect==2:foriinrange(right,left-1,-1):res.append(matrix[down][i])down-=1ifdirect==3:foriinrange(down,up-1,-1):res.append(matrix[i][left])left+=1ifup>down or left>right:returnres...
螺旋矩阵 Given an integern, generate a square matrix filled with elements from 1 ton2 in spiral order. For example, Givenn=3, You should return the following matrix: [ [ 1, 2, 3 ], [ 8, 9, 4 ], [ 7, 6, 5 ] ] 看博客园有人面试碰到过这个问题,长篇大论看得我头晕。跑去leet...
Spiral Matrix IV(Python) bofei yan 懒人 来自专栏 · python算法题笔记 递归解法 class Solution: def spiralMatrix(self, m: int, n: int, head: Optional[ListNode]) -> List[List[int]]: res = [[-1 for j in range(n)] for i in range(m)] self.helper(m, n, 0, 0, "r", head, ...
[Leetcode][python]Spiral Matrix/Spiral Matrix II/螺旋矩阵/螺旋矩阵 II,SpiralMatrix题目大意将一个矩阵中的内容螺旋输出。注意点:矩阵不一定是正方形例子:输入:matrix=[[1,2,3],[4,5,6],[7,8,9]]输出:[1,2,3,6,9,8,7,4,5]解题思路看代码就可以理解代码classSolution(
这个题由于没有给matrix,所以自己生成一个正方形的矩阵,然后把54题的读取matrix的值改为给matrix当前位置填写值即可。 维护四个边界和运动方向 螺旋填充,一定会在遍历的时候更改方向。在什么时候更改方向呢?在最外圈运动的时候是到达边界的时候。但是当移动到Example 1中4的位置时,要向右移动(而不是向上),那么相当...
python 输出: 2. 螺旋矩阵 II Spiral Matrix ii 给你一个正整数n,生成一个包含1到n2所有元素,且元素按顺时针顺序螺旋排列的n x n正方形矩阵matrix。 示例1: 输入:n = 3 输出:[[1,2,3],[8,9,4],[7,6,5]] 示例2: 输入:n = 1
matrix[x][endy] = num++; } // 如果行或列遍历完,则退出循环 if (startx == endx || starty == endy) { break; } // 下边的行,从右向左 for (int y = endy - 1; y >= starty; y--) { matrix[endx][y] = num++;
Can you solve this real interview question? Spiral Matrix - Given an m x n matrix, return all elements of the matrix in spiral order. Example 1: [https://assets.leetcode.com/uploads/2020/11/13/spiral1.jpg] Input: matrix = [[1,2,3],[4,5,6],[7,8,9]]
Stanford University Rad229 Class Code: MRI Signals and Sequences matlabmatrixmriepgspiralepigriddingmri-signalsbloch UpdatedMay 21, 2025 Jupyter Notebook A Metal-backed, blazingly fast alternative to CAGradientLayer. macosiossweepgradientspiralcalayerradialaxial ...